在当今的数字时代,iOS软件制作已成为许多开发者和企业家的重要技能。随着苹果设备的普及和App Store的繁荣,掌握iOS软件制作的技巧和策略变得至关重要。以下是一份详细的iOS软件制作全攻略,涵盖了从基础到高级的多个方面,旨在帮助读者全面了解iOS软件开发的步骤与技巧。
1. 理解iOS开发环境
首先,需要熟悉iOS的开发环境,包括Xcode、Swift或Objective-C等编程语言以及相关工具。了解这些工具的功能和使用方法对于后续的开发工作至关重要。
2. 学习编程基础
对于初学者来说,学习编程基础知识是必要的。这包括了解变量、数据类型、条件语句、循环等基本概念。此外,还需要熟悉如何使用Swift或Objective-C进行编程,这两种语言都是iOS开发的官方支持语言。
3. 设计用户界面
设计一个吸引人的用户界面是iOS软件开发的关键。这包括选择合适的主题颜色、图标和字体,以及创建布局和元素。使用Interface Builder可以帮助开发者更轻松地设计和实现用户界面。
4. 编写代码
在掌握了基本的编程知识和用户界面设计之后,可以开始编写代码来实现应用程序的功能。这包括处理用户输入、执行业务逻辑、显示结果等。使用Swift或Objective-C进行编程,并确保代码的正确性和可读性。
5. 测试和调试
在开发过程中,测试和调试是必不可少的环节。通过运行模拟器或真机来测试应用程序的功能,找出并修复错误。使用Xcode提供的调试工具可以帮助开发者更容易地定位问题并进行修复。
6. 发布和分发应用
完成开发后,需要将应用程序发布到App Store或其他分发平台。这包括准备应用程序的描述、截图、视频等内容,以及遵循苹果的规则和要求。发布过程可能需要多次提交和审核,因此需要耐心和细致。
7. 持续学习和改进
最后,作为一名iOS开发者,需要不断学习和改进自己的技能。关注最新的技术和趋势,参加培训课程或加入开发者社区,与其他开发者交流经验,可以帮助提升自己的开发水平。
总之,iOS软件制作是一个充满挑战和机遇的过程。通过遵循上述步骤和技巧,开发者可以逐步提高自己的技能,开发出高质量的应用程序。同时,也需要保持开放的心态,积极学习和适应新的技术和趋势,以保持竞争力并实现个人和职业的成长。